Charing railway station
Railway station
Photo: Le Deluge,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Charing railway station serves the village of Charing in Kent, England. It is 53 miles 11 chains down the line from London Victoria. The station, and all trains serving it, is operated by Southeastern. Charing railway station is situated 1½ miles east of Church of the Holy Trinity.
Lenham railway station
Railway station
Photo: Stephen Craven,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Lenham railway station serves Lenham in Kent, England. It is 49 miles 11 chains down the line from London Victoria. The station, and all trains serving it, is/ are operated by Southeastern. The station has two tracks running through and two platforms. Lenham railway station is situated 2½ miles northwest of Church of the Holy Trinity.

Boughton Malherbe
Village
Photo: Dave Skinner,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Boughton Malherbe is a village and civil parish in the Maidstone district of Kent, England, equidistant between Maidstone and Ashford. According to the 2001 census the parish had a population of 428, including Sandway and Grafty Green, increasing to 476 at the 2011 Census. Boughton Malherbe is situated 2½ miles west of Church of the Holy Trinity.
Sandway
Hamlet
Sandway is a hamlet about 1-mile to the south-west of Lenham in the Maidstone district of Kent, England. The population is included in the civil parish of Boughton Malherbe. Sandway is situated 2½ miles northwest of Church of the Holy Trinity.
